Overview

A beautiful, popular life of the Patron of Lost Objects, a powerful intercessor, and the favorite saint of Catholics. He was the greatest preacher of the middle ages and one of the finest orators of all time. Find out why he is called the Wonder-Worker and the Hammer of Heretics Includes the famous stories of St. Anthony and the Christ Child, St. Anthony and the Mule, preaching to the fishes, and more. 126 pgs, PB
